AWARE Society in partnership with Discovery Community College is offering a Project Based Labour Market Training Program that will prepare you for a career as a Teacher’s Assistant. Gain the skills to support students with special and diverse learning needs.

Eligibility Criteria:

  • Must be an unemployed or underemployed B.C. resident legally entitled to work in Canada.
  • Currently receiving EI Benefits OR have had an EI claim within the last 5 years,
    OR have earned more than $2000.00 in insurable earnings and paid EI premiums on those earnings in at least 5 of the last 10 years
  • OR be in receipt of BCEA or PWD benefits.
  • Must be referred by a WorkBC Employment Service Centre Case Manager.
  • Undergo a Criminal Record Check prior to program start date.

Program Includes:

  • 25 weeks inclusive of a 4-week practicum
  • First Aid, Violence Prevention & Food Safe certification
  • Indigenous focused cultural competenices components
  • Employability & job search skills support
  • 100% funded for eligible participants
